 "Evet - I do"

 

 An exhibition that opened Aug. 17 at Dortmund Museum of Art and Culture History in Germany focuses on the increasing closeness of Turkish and German cultures following the 1960s migration of Turkish workers to the country. The exhibition, titled “Yes-Ja, Ich Will! Wedding Culture and Fashion from 1800s to Today: A German-Turk Encounter,” displays the similarities between Turkish and German weddings. It reminds visitors of the old traditions which are being forgotten. The exhibition may also provide wedding ideas to couples planning to marry soon.

The Museum of Art and Cultural History in Dortmund, Germany, welcomes "Evet-Ja, Ich Will! Wedding Rituals and Trends from 1800 to Present." This exhibition will present German and Turkish nuptial traditions, both modern and historic, and will reflect on Turkish-German cultural relations since the migration of Turkish workers to Germany in the 1960s. The exhibit consists of 272 works of art, on loan from the Ethnography Museum of Ankara, Istanbul´s Museum of Turkish and Islamic Art, the Topkapi Palace Museum and private collections. "Evet-Ja, Ich Will!" opens on Aug. 17 and will remain open until Jan. 25, 2009.
